On Mer, 2006-02-08 at 15:44 +0000, Chris Boot wrote:
> My next step will be to play with the CD drive. Any hints on 
> stress-testing the drive? Obviously writing a CD then comparing to the 
> ISO will be one step, but any others?

The PATA specific code is almost entirely in the setup stages. Once the
setup is done then (with the exception of early PIIX devices, radisys,
triflex and a couple of other oddities) there is no "new" code actually
being run.
